Output 34a3b6426fb87a116543b0c3cabb0b1781eb3a8ccaf5f8c227d20a59f58b335c:0

value
243452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fea4959c767b48c453be2e8fe6bb138213d56b3 OP_EQUAL
address
3KBmehMZUbcX7bVSfpCY4oCSNWXtKTj4fQ
transaction
34a3b6426fb87a116543b0c3cabb0b1781eb3a8ccaf5f8c227d20a59f58b335c
spent
true